Abstract
We construct uncountably many discrete groups of type ; in particular we construct groups of type that do not embed in any finitely presented group. We compute the ordinary, - and compactly-supported cohomology of these groups. For each we construct a closed aspherical -manifold that admits an uncountable family of acyclic regular coverings with non-isomorphic covering groups.
